Merge tag 'v5.10-next-soc' of git://git.kernel.org/pub/scm/linux/kernel/git/matthias.bgg/linux into arm/drivers
power-domains: - add support for new power domain driver. - add support for mt8183 and mt8192 devapc: - add support for the devapc device found on mt6779 to identify of malicious bus accesses from a controller to a device mmsys: - move DDP routing IDs into the driver cmdq: - drop timeout handler support as not usefull scpsys: - print warning on theoretical error * tag 'v5.10-next-soc' of git://git.kernel.org/pub/scm/linux/kernel/git/matthias.bgg/linux: (21 commits) soc: mediatek: mmsys: Use devm_platform_ioremap_resource() soc / drm: mediatek: Move DDP component defines into mtk-mmsys.h soc: mediatek: add mt6779 devapc driver dt-bindings: devapc: add bindings for mtk-devapc soc / drm: mediatek: cmdq: Remove timeout handler in helper function soc: mediatek: pm-domains: Add support for mt8192 soc: mediatek: pm-domains: Add default power off flag soc: mediatek: pm-domains: Add support for mt8183 soc: mediatek: pm-domains: Allow bus protection to ignore clear ack soc: mediatek: pm-domains: Add subsystem clocks soc: mediatek: pm-domains: Add extra sram control soc: mediatek: pm-domains: Add SMI block as bus protection block soc: mediatek: pm_domains: Make bus protection generic soc: mediatek: pm-domains: Add bus protection protocol soc: mediatek: Add MediaTek SCPSYS power domains dt-bindings: power: Add MT8192 power domains dt-bindings: power: Add MT8183 power domains dt-bindings: power: Add bindings for the Mediatek SCPSYS power domains controller mfd: syscon: Add syscon_regmap_lookup_by_phandle_optional() function.
